Rules for processing cucumbers from diseases

Cucumbers are a vegetable crop that is very demanding on temperature conditions, watering, it is easily affected by fungal and viral diseases. They, in turn, shorten the growing season, affect the quantity and quality of the crop. Preventive treatment of cucumbers from diseases, timely diagnosis and treatment will help to avoid losses.

Powdery mildew

Symptoms

The disease most often develops in cloudy cool weather. The first signs are white spots on the leaves, resembling flour. Over time, their number increases, they merge, affecting the entire sheet.Ultimately, the leaves dry out, the lashes cease to grow and bear fruit.

Powdery mildew affects plants that receive nitrogen in excess, are deficient in moisture. You can prevent the development of the disease by eliminating the favorable conditions. Helps prevent mildew from being damaged by proper crop rotation, destruction of plant debris.

Prevention and treatment

The treatment of cucumber shoots with Topaz is effective at the initial stage of the disease. This systemic fungicide is also used for prevention at the beginning of the growing season. It has the following advantages:

  • is rapidly absorbed by plants, so there is no risk of rinsing;
  • has a high speed and duration of action: it infects the pathogen for 2-3 hours and retains a therapeutic effect 2 -2.5 weeks;
  • well tolerated by most garden crops;
  • low consumption rates.

Topaz is used in the treatment of other diseases: fruit and gray rot, rust, purple spots, etc.

To prepare the working solution, the contents of the ampoule (2 ml) are dissolved in 10 l of water. How much to spend depends on the phase of development of the plant and the degree of disease damage. One ampoule is enough on average to process 1 hundred parts.

False powdery mildew

Symptoms

The appearance of a plant with peronosporosis (downy mildew) is indicated by the appearance of a large number of light yellow spots that have an oily surface. A plaque forms on the back of the sheet plate. Then the leaves turn yellow, acquire a brown tint and dry. Buds and flowers turn black and fall.

Like other fungal diseases, peronosporosis is more likely to occur after rain. It can be provoked by watering cucumber beds with cold water. A disease can destroy a bush in a week. The disease spreads very quickly in the greenhouse.

Prevention and treatment

Heat the seedling trays. Seeds of cucumbers must be etched (you can Epin), planting is carried out in disinfected soil. If you do not allow:

  • sudden changes in temperature;
  • waterlogging of air and moisture on the leaves;
  • thickening of plants
  • and water cucumbers with warm water, then the risk of developing downy mildew will be minimized.

Fungicides, for example, Ridomil, have a good preventive and therapeutic effect. The cucumbers and soil are treated with a soap-soda solution. For treatment, the procedure is repeated several times with an interval of 7 days. Before spraying, it is necessary to remove and burn damaged leaves, shoots, otherwise the effect of the use of drugs will be reduced to zero.

Gray rot

Signs

Infection affects all parts of the plant: roots, leaves, stems, flowers, fruits are covered with brown spots with gray spore-containing plaque. By the wind they are transferred to neighboring bushes, beds. The danger of gray rot is that it quickly spreads among vegetables, berries, garden plants.

Treatment

In addition to observing crop rotation and basic rules for caring for cucumbers, to avoid lesions with gray rot should be sprayed with fungicides (Fitosporin, 1% solution of Bordeaux fluid), a solution prepared from 1 glass of ash, 1 glass of chalk, 1 tsp. vitriol and 10 liters of water.

Fusarium

Symptoms

The disease is caused by fungi that affect the entire plant. Leaves begin to fade. The bush may die if measures are not taken. The danger of fusarium is that it can not be diagnosed immediately. Seeds or seedlings may be infected. The disease manifests itself during the flowering and fruiting period. The sooner they find it, the less harm it can do. If the vessels of the leaf, stem are affected, they acquire a brown color.As soon as the first signs of wilting are manifested, such a diagnosis is carried out. After that, they immediately begin treatment.

Prevention and treatment

Start with seed preparation. Gardeners speak well of Fundazole, Previkura. Two days before transplanting, the soil is treated with biological products. After you need to spray the seedlings:

  • suitable biological products Trichodermin, Bactofit, Trichophytum;
  • to increase immunity, seeds and seedlings are treated with Humisol;
  • at the initial stage of the disease use drugs Quadris, Gymnast, Acrobat.

A solution of whey with the addition of copper sulfate (per 10 liters of water 4 liters of serum and 1.5 tsp vitriol) also helps.

Pests of cucumbers and their control

Often the reason that the leaves of the cucumbers turn yellow, become stained and dry out is the pests. Most often, the culture is affected by aphids, spider mites, whiteflies. Pests can become carriers of dangerous diseases of vegetable crops.

Aphids and ticks settle on the back of the leaf. They pierce the plant tissue and feed on its juices, as a result of which the described symptoms appear. The defeat of cucumber bushes with a tick is evidenced by a barely noticeable cobweb. The size of the insects is very small: aphids up to 2 mm, tick – 0.5 mm. The appearance of whiteflies can be recognized by dark spots on the leaves: it secretes sugary substances on which sooty mushrooms settle.

It is possible to prevent the occurrence of pests if weeds are destroyed in a timely manner, the soil is decontaminated in the spring, before sowing seeds or transplanting seedlings. Pest larvae hibernate in plant debris.

For the prevention and control of insects, cucumbers need to be treated several times with insecticides: Fufanon, Intavir (Inta-Vir), Aktara, Bi-58. It has been established that pests can become addicted to the active substance, therefore it is advisable to change the preparations for repeated treatments.

Industrial fungicides can be dangerous to plants, insects, animals and humans. The use of pharmacy drugs, “home” remedies is becoming increasingly popular.

Folk remedies

How to treat cucumbers from diseases:

  • mullein infusion (1 kg per 3 l water, stand 3 days, drain, add another 3 liters of water);
  • sour milk (mixed with water 1: 1);
  • baking soda with laundry soap (diluted 50 g in 10 liters of warm water).

The treatment is carried out at least 2-3 times with an interval of 1 week.

Furacilin

Gardeners share the experience of preventive and therapeutic spraying with furacilin.An inexpensive drug that is used to use for gargling, treating wounds, will help cope with powdery mildew. To do this, cucumbers need to be treated with a solution prepared from 10 tablets and 2 liters of hot water (tablets do not dissolve well in cold). For prevention, you can take 10 liters of water for such a number of tablets.

Metronidazole

In the fight against various types of bacterial and fungal diseases of cucumbers, spraying with Metronidazole (an analog of Trichopolum) will help. Preventive treatments are carried out with a preparation prepared from 1 g of Trichopolum (4 tablets) and 10 l of warm water (some gardeners add a bottle of greenery). For treatment, the concentration is tripled: 3 g (12 tablets). Handle so that the liquid penetrates into the affected area. A less concentrated solution is also suitable for root watering.

Garlic

Many hosts use alternative pest control agents instead of insecticides. Cucumbers are treated with garlic. The tincture is prepared as follows:

  • chop the cloves;
  • pour water in a 1: 1 ratio;
  • I insist in a dark place for 7-10 days.

To spray the cucumbers, take 50 ml of tincture in a bucket of water. For better adhesion add laundry soap or detergent. Processing cucumber beds with garlic will also help against fungal diseases.
